Sod Installation

How to Install Sod

Understand the basic steps that help new sod establish cleanly after delivery.

Successful sod installation depends on soil preparation, fresh delivery timing, clean layout, and immediate watering.

Prepare the Soil

Clear old growth, finish grade the area, and create a smooth, firm surface before sod arrives.

Install Promptly

Fresh sod should be laid as soon as practical. Stagger seams and keep edges tight.

Water Immediately

Begin watering right away so the sod and soil beneath stay consistently moist during establishment.

Protect the New Lawn

Limit traffic while roots establish and follow watering and mowing guidance for the sod variety.
